Description

Pre-market Engagement for the Provision of a Merchant Service for Essex County Council

Essex County Council (ECC) is at an early stage in procuring a Merchant Service Solution, and prior to formulating any formal procurement opportunity, seeks input from the market.

The council is looking for the intended solution to provide the following:

a. Provide back-end Merchant Card Acquiring Services to take all ECC card and wallet type, including but not limited to ApplePay, AndroidPay and SamsungPay or take card payments as part of the day-to-day services provided by ECC. These include but are not limited to all electronic payments, ECC Registration Services, ACL, Blue Badge, Libraries, County Parks and Outdoor Centres and many more.
b. needs to be able to supply a variety of hardware solutions including: Fixed terminals, Mobile terminals, Bluetooth terminals, Contactless terminals, Unattended terminals, P2PE terminals, Virtual terminals.
c. Need to have accreditation with our Finance System provider Access Suite/ Access Group/ PaySuite as part of the interface.
d. Provide any current and upcoming innovations on a quarterly/ annual basis.
e. Potential and/or known demand/volumes for requirement, e.g. Six training courses for 10 attendees or volume of goods. Currently, we have 40+ merchant IDs. 29 MIDs are used for terminals supplied by current Merchant Acquirer and rest of them are used for terminals supplied by Access Group and average volume of transaction per annum is c480,000.
f. Anticipated interfaces within ECC systems, specifically software/hardware which may need to work on ECC's infrastructure. We will require an interface for reporting purposes. This would be required via HTTPS API, SFTP and secured email with the option for access via Single Sign on access.
